Robert Drury
Career Summary Bob Drury is a Senior Manager of BSG's Distribution, Logistics, & IT Services in our end-to-end Supply Chain Management practice. He has more than thirty-five years experience in
retail logistics, distribution, food manufacturing and information technology management, with a proven track record as a industry thought leader, strategist, and turn around manager.
Experience
Prior to his retirement, Bob served as Senior Vice President for Logistics, Manufacturing, & Information Technology for Schnuck Markets, a major self distributing Midwest retailer. In this position, he was responsible for strategic planning, innovation and delivery of a broad array of services in support of retail operations. These duties included direct responsibility for all warehouse operations, private fleet management, internal manufacturing of a full line of dairy and bakery products, and delivery of all corporate, support facility, and store level information technology services.
Highlights of his IT work included an end to end re- engineering of all financial, merchandising, and point of sale systems based on open systems architecture, implementation of real time Engineered Standards and Interactive Voice Response systems to improve productivity and accuracy in warehouse operations, and an industry first, cell phone based GPS tracking of the distribution fleet. In 1995, Schnuck Markets was recognized by Computer World Magazine as a Premier 100 Leader in Internet Technology for the development of one of the first internet based, home delivery systems in the US Retail Grocery industry.
From a logistics perspective, Bob was responsible for the design and implementation of a multi-commodity, multi-temperature, point of sale driven, paperless, store order and delivery system, that increased the frequency of store service, cut store order lead times in half, and minimized back room inventories while reducing the number of transport miles needed to provide the service by over 15%. In addition, he managed the successful outsourcing of two major warehouse operations.
Prior to joining Schnuck Markets, Bob was Chief Information Officer at Pet Incorporated, a global, multi billion dollar packaged food manufacturer. For innovation in using the Electronic Data Interchange Standards as a corporate data model for systems development and software package integration, Pet Incorporated was honored as a Premier 100 Information Technology Leader by Computer World in 1990.
Bob is also an Adjunct Professor in the School of Engineering at Washington University in St. Louis, MO, where he lectures on End-to-End Supply Chain Management. He has also served as Chairman Emeritus of the Center for the Study of Data Processing at the same university. In addition, he also helped found the Consortium for Supply Chain Management Studies at the John Cook School of Business at St. Louis University.
Bob’s industry background includes a seat on the Board of Governors of the Uniform Code Council, Director of Efficient Consumer Response for the Grocery Manufacturers of America (GMA), membership on the Food Marketing Institute AMIS Committee, and membership on Information Technology Committee of GMA.
